Protein is rich in amino acids and is essential for the human body because it helps to the develop the muscles and acts as an enzyme. A common problem for the vegetarians is that they don’t get enough protein and there may be the risk of not receiving the daily recommended quantity. Nevertheless, there are plenty meat alternatives that vegetarians can consume so they can have a healthy diet.

Beans, peas and lentils

They are all excellent sources of protein. They can be eaten every day and there are various cooking methods to make them more delicious. Aside from proteins, They also have some other nutrients that are good for your body and they contain many fibers. The best examples are the soybeans that contain complete proteins and all the essential amino acids.

Dairy products

If your diet allows it, you can add some dairy products that are rich in protein such as eggs, cheese, yogurt and milk. From all these products, eggs contain the largest amount of proteins and you can eat maximum one egg a day. A good idea is to introduce low fat dairy products to your diet if you want to maintain your health.


Another great protein source is represented by vegetables. Among them, the best choices are are the potatoes, broccoli, cabbage, or tomatoes that are a great source of vitamin C, beta-carotene, iron, calcium and fiber. They are very helpful in creating a healthy meal while offering you diversity.


You should include in your diet at least one meal of fruits that contain vitamin C, such as citrus fruits, strawberries pineapples or melons. In addition, dried fruits are a great provider of minerals, vitamins and some fiber.

Nuts and seeds

They are great as snacks for vegetarians and they come in various shapes: almonds, pistachio, walnuts, pumpkin and sunflower seeds, and many others. They are crunchy and tasty and should definitely be added to any vegetarian diet. They contain many healthy fats, but also fiber and protein, having few carbohydrates. Therefore, you should be careful and eat them moderately if you want to avoid gaining weight.


Having a highly significant benefit, whole grains should be served every day. They include bread, pasta, wheat or rice and are rich in additional nutrients: iron, zinc and vitamin B-12, which can also be found in seafood.

Introducing these simple sources of protein into your daily life will help you improve your health condition. Proteins are very important and those who follow a vegetarian diet should make sure that they get the proteins from the proper aliments.